Blaize
Also spelled: Blasius, Blas
Pronunciation: BLAYZ
Meaning
Flame, stutter, lisp
Origin
Latin, English
About Blaize
Blaize ignites a spark for parents seeking a name that’s both bold and contemporary. With roots in Latin and English, carrying the vivid meaning of "flame," this unisex choice feels energetic and modern. It’s a name that doesn’t shy away from attention, perfect for a child destined to make their mark. Unlike many fiery names, Blaize also carries an intriguing, softer historical echo through its association with "stutter" or "lisp," adding a layer of unexpected depth to its otherwise vibrant persona. This duality makes Blaize appealing to those who appreciate a name with a strong, dynamic sound but also a touch of ancient, almost poetic vulnerability.
